Output 96e447c652bb41b89352c247a79b4b9d207f50a76a8a9172aa74569a1752ea7f:0

value
18556616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a94e740ccb75e92478140693987bda1761a33d04 OP_EQUAL
address
MPLNQt6ZrJi7g4zWow7P317XHEseq2zyVW
transaction
96e447c652bb41b89352c247a79b4b9d207f50a76a8a9172aa74569a1752ea7f
spent
true